.PixelButton-module__avHIPa__btn{color:var(--text);cursor:pointer;-webkit-user-select:none;user-select:none;border:2px solid var(--border);border-radius:10px;padding:10px 12px;font-family:"Press Start 2P",monospace;font-size:10px;transition:opacity .12s;transform:translateY(0);box-shadow:0 6px #00000073}.PixelButton-module__avHIPa__disabled{cursor:not-allowed;opacity:.55}.PixelButton-module__avHIPa__inner{align-items:center;gap:10px;display:inline-flex}.PixelButton-module__avHIPa__icon{font-size:12px}.PixelButton-module__avHIPa__primary{background:#0f2d66;border-color:#2f66d1;box-shadow:0 6px #00000073,inset 0 2px #15449a}.PixelButton-module__avHIPa__ghost{border-color:var(--border);background:#0b1220;box-shadow:0 6px #00000073,inset 0 2px #111b2c}.PixelButton-module__avHIPa__success{border-color:var(--green);background:#123d2b;box-shadow:0 6px #00000073,inset 0 2px #1a5a3f}.PixelButton-module__avHIPa__pressed{transform:translateY(2px);box-shadow:0 4px #00000073}
.HeroGate-module__2VQqLW__hero{border-bottom:2px solid var(--border);background:radial-gradient(at top,#0b1220 0%,#05070b 60%);padding:28px 16px 18px;position:relative;overflow:hidden}.HeroGate-module__2VQqLW__scanlines:after{content:"";pointer-events:none;mix-blend-mode:overlay;opacity:.12;background:repeating-linear-gradient(#ffffff0d 0 1px,#0000 3px);position:absolute;inset:0}.HeroGate-module__2VQqLW__inner{text-align:center;max-width:980px;margin:0 auto}.HeroGate-module__2VQqLW__mascot{place-items:center;margin-bottom:12px;display:grid}.HeroGate-module__2VQqLW__mascotImg{filter:drop-shadow(0 10px 18px #0009);width:76px;height:76px}.HeroGate-module__2VQqLW__titleRow{margin-bottom:8px}.HeroGate-module__2VQqLW__title{font-size:18px;line-height:1.2}.HeroGate-module__2VQqLW__badge{opacity:.85;border:2px solid var(--border);border-radius:999px;margin-left:10px;padding:4px 8px;font-size:9px;display:inline-block}.HeroGate-module__2VQqLW__subtitle{color:var(--muted);margin-bottom:18px;font-size:10px;line-height:1.6}.HeroGate-module__2VQqLW__gateButtons{flex-wrap:wrap;justify-content:center;gap:10px;margin-bottom:16px;display:flex}.HeroGate-module__2VQqLW__panel{text-align:left;background:linear-gradient(180deg,var(--panel)0%,var(--panel2)100%);border:2px solid var(--border);max-width:860px;box-shadow:0 18px 60px var(--shadow);border-radius:12px;margin:0 auto;padding:14px}.HeroGate-module__2VQqLW__panelTop{justify-content:space-between;align-items:center;gap:12px;margin-bottom:10px;display:flex}.HeroGate-module__2VQqLW__panelTitle{letter-spacing:.6px;font-size:11px}.HeroGate-module__2VQqLW__tabs{border:2px solid var(--border);background:#050a14;border-radius:10px;display:inline-flex;overflow:hidden}.HeroGate-module__2VQqLW__tabBtn{color:var(--muted);cursor:pointer;background:0 0;border:none;padding:10px 14px;font-family:"Press Start 2P",monospace;font-size:9px}.HeroGate-module__2VQqLW__tabActive{color:var(--text);background:#0f2d66}.HeroGate-module__2VQqLW__codeBox{border:2px solid var(--border);background:#04060a;border-radius:12px;padding:12px}.HeroGate-module__2VQqLW__pre{white-space:pre-wrap;word-break:break-word;color:#e7f0ffe0;margin:0;font-size:9px;line-height:1.65}.HeroGate-module__2VQqLW__actionsRow{flex-wrap:wrap;align-items:center;gap:10px;margin-top:12px;display:flex}.HeroGate-module__2VQqLW__linkBtn{text-decoration:none}.HeroGate-module__2VQqLW__steps{color:#e7f0ffc7;gap:8px;margin-top:12px;font-size:9px;line-height:1.6;display:grid}.HeroGate-module__2VQqLW__step b{color:var(--text)}.HeroGate-module__2VQqLW__inlineLink{color:#e7f0fff2;text-decoration:underline}.HeroGate-module__2VQqLW__note{color:#e7f0ffb3;opacity:.95;margin-top:14px;font-size:9px;line-height:1.6}.HeroGate-module__2VQqLW__noteSmall{opacity:.75;margin-top:6px}
.GamePanel-module__3jdsmW__wrapper{padding:16px}.GamePanel-module__3jdsmW__grid{align-items:stretch;gap:16px;max-width:1280px;margin:0 auto;display:flex}.GamePanel-module__3jdsmW__panel{background:linear-gradient(180deg,var(--panel)0%,var(--panel2)100%);border:2px solid var(--border);box-shadow:0 18px 60px var(--shadow);border-radius:12px;flex:1;overflow:hidden}.GamePanel-module__3jdsmW__header{border-bottom:2px solid var(--border);align-items:center;gap:10px;padding:12px;display:flex}.GamePanel-module__3jdsmW__title{font-size:11px}.GamePanel-module__3jdsmW__meta{color:var(--muted);opacity:.95;font-size:9px}.GamePanel-module__3jdsmW__right{color:var(--muted);margin-left:auto;font-size:9px}.GamePanel-module__3jdsmW__searchRow{border-bottom:2px solid var(--border);background:#0000002e;align-items:center;gap:10px;padding:10px 12px;display:flex}.GamePanel-module__3jdsmW__searchInput{height:34px;color:var(--text);border:2px solid var(--border);background:#00000059;border-radius:10px;outline:none;flex:1;padding:0 10px;font-size:10px}.GamePanel-module__3jdsmW__searchInput:focus{border-color:var(--accent);box-shadow:0 0 0 2px #ffffff14}.GamePanel-module__3jdsmW__searchStatus{color:var(--muted);border-bottom:2px solid var(--border);padding:8px 12px;font-size:9px}.GamePanel-module__3jdsmW__footer{border-top:2px solid var(--border);padding:12px}.GamePanel-module__3jdsmW__footerTitle{margin-bottom:8px;font-size:10px}.GamePanel-module__3jdsmW__feed{max-height:140px;color:var(--muted);font-size:9px;line-height:1.6;overflow:auto}.GamePanel-module__3jdsmW__feedRow{padding:2px 0}.GamePanel-module__3jdsmW__sidebar{width:360px}
.RosterPanel-module__VvMjmG__panel{background:linear-gradient(180deg,var(--panel)0%,var(--panel2)100%);border:2px solid var(--border);box-shadow:0 18px 60px var(--shadow);border-radius:12px;overflow:hidden}.RosterPanel-module__VvMjmG__header{border-bottom:2px solid var(--border);padding:12px;font-size:11px}.RosterPanel-module__VvMjmG__section{padding:12px}.RosterPanel-module__VvMjmG__sectionTitle{opacity:.9;margin-bottom:10px;font-size:10px}.RosterPanel-module__VvMjmG__list{gap:8px;display:grid}.RosterPanel-module__VvMjmG__card{border:2px solid var(--border);background:#07101f;border-radius:10px;align-items:center;gap:10px;padding:10px;display:flex}.RosterPanel-module__VvMjmG__dot{border-radius:2px;width:10px;height:10px}.RosterPanel-module__VvMjmG__name{flex:1;font-size:9px;line-height:1.4}.RosterPanel-module__VvMjmG__badge{color:var(--muted);opacity:.75;margin-top:2px;font-size:9px;line-height:1.5}.RosterPanel-module__VvMjmG__mass{opacity:.9;font-size:9px}.RosterPanel-module__VvMjmG__divider{border-top:2px solid var(--border)}
